Valentin Software

Valentin Software develops user-friendly planning and simulation software for sustainable energy supply in buildings. Our range of services comprises industry-specific software for photovoltaics and solar-thermal energy as well as the implementation of individual solutions.

With 20 years of successful business experience and solid technical expertise, Valentin Software has succeeded in becoming the market leader for planning and simulation software in the field of renewable energy. Customers from over 70 countries around the world use our programs, which are available in German, English, Spanish, French, and Italian. Our company has its headquarters in Berlin and employs some 40 people. A team of specialist engineers and software developers is constantly working to refine and optimize our products. Regular updates ensure that our customers always have the latest versions of their software.

    The Solar Design Company was founded in 1993 by Chris Laughton, who remains today as the Managing Director. The Solar Design Company is the official UK Business Partner for Valentin Software’s simulation software for solar PV, thermal & heat pumps.

    The company’s principal activity is the supply of PV*SOL, T*SOL & GeoT*SOL software, which they have been distributing since April 2006. They specialise in providing English-language training in the use of the software as well as supplementary solar equipment to optimise system efficiency.

    Managing Director Chris Laughton is a well-known solar engineer, author and lecturer with 20 years’ experience in solar heating. He is a Fellow of The Institute of Domestic Heating and Environmental Engineers (FIDHEE) and regularly produces specialist editorials for publications such as Green Building Magazine, PHAM, Electrical Times, Energy in Buildings & Industry, Renewable Energy World and Wind&Sun. He has published several well-regarded books on solar thermal and wood heating, the most recent of which is Solar Domestic Water Heating for international publisher Earthscan. He supervises a small team of dedicated people located at an old refurbished railway building in Machynlleth, mid-Wales.
